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"via the networking" is not standard in written English and may sound awkward.
It could be used in contexts discussing methods of communication or connection through networks, but it is better to use more common expressions. Example: "We were able to share the information via the networking of our professional contacts."

Ludwig's WRAP-UP
In summary, while technically understandable, the phrase "via the networking" is not considered standard or particularly graceful in English writing. Ludwig AI's analysis indicates it may sound awkward. More common and accepted alternatives include "through networking" or "by networking", offering clearer and more concise ways to express the same concept. Using simpler language will likely improve the overall readability and professionalism of your writing. Although examples can be found, they are infrequent and scattered across various contexts, suggesting it is not a widely adopted phrase. The recommendation is to favor the simpler alternatives.
